This set of 130 statistical tables shows the numbers and percent distributions from Census 2000 for the American Indian and Alaska Native Alone and Alone or in Combination Population by Tribe.
Tables 1 to 65 show numbers for the United States, regions, divisions and states.
Tables 66 to 130 show percents for the United States, regions, divisions and states.
In the column entitled, "American Indian and Alaska Native Tribes," "Monacan" was incorrectly spelled as "Monocan." In addition, the ‘‘Mono’’ tribal grouping that includes separate data lines for "Mono," "North Fork Rancheria," "Cold Springs Rancheria," and "Big Sandy Rancheria," was incorrectly indented under the "Monacan" tribal grouping. These groups should have been listed separately under the "Mono" tribal grouping. As a result of this error, the data shown for the "Monacan" tribal grouping are incorrect, and there are no data shown for the "Mono" tribal grouping. Data for each of the individual tribes, i.e., "Monacan Indian Nation," "Mono," "North Fork Rancheria," "Cold Springs Rancheria," and "Big Sandy Rancheria," are correct as shown.
